Here are the specs:

2012 Wilkins VRB5 JJ Namm Build
Body:Chambered
Top: Mango w/Matching Head Stock
Back: Alder w/Lite tint
Neck: Eastern Maple C Shape
Finger Board: Indian Rosewood
Nut Width: 1 7/8
Scale: 34"
Electronics: Wilkins 5 J Pickups
John Suhr 3 band Preamp.
Frets: 6230 Vintage
Hardware: Hipshot Tuners, Vintage Style Bridge
Weight: 8-9 lbs
